Sleeping arrangements in rear conversion
Hi Mark, Here's some photos showing the wedge pillows in place, self inflating camping mat on top, plus the laundry bag which fit the wedge pillows perfectly. Note, you'll see a gap between the thick end of the wedge and the seat back, we sleep with our heads at the back end, it's only our legs lying on that bit, so very little weight pressing down and with a good self inflating camping mat on top it feels pretty flat to me, and believe me, I'm a fussy sleeper! Just for your reference, I'm 6'1".

Sleeping arrangements in rear conversion
I have a rear conversion and found 2 medical wedge shaped pillows fit perfectly on the seats and create a very flat bed. With those and a self inflating camping mat (Berghaus) ontop, I don't notice any undulations. They're not the cheapest, at £24.95 each, but I think they're definitely worth it! Look on Amazon for : Waterproof Acid Reflux Flex Foam Large Wedge Support Sleeping Tilter Pillow-White(71cmx60cmx14cm) I also bought some laundry bags to store them in and they're a perfect size to get both pillows in when turned 180 degrees to each other (being wedge shaped), Amazon: VIROSA EXTRA LARGE Strong and Durable Laundry Bags | PACK of 5 | 80cm x 60cm
